Audit

Hygiene Standards External Vertical and Horizontal
GOOD
• No weeds or grain residues within 9 metres of storages
• Drains and gutters free of grain, bees wings and dust
• Machinery, equipment and tools stored in their place (5S)
• No presence of general rubbish
FAIR
• Attempt made to clean grain residues around storage
• Scrap bin containing residues, but not neglected (doesn’t require emptying as yet)
• Grain spills picked up off rail siding
• Odd weeds scattered around storage
• Odd pieces of machinery, equipment and tools scattered around storage
POOR
• Area neglected
• No attempt to clean grain residues around storage
• Scrap bin containing rotting grain residues for long periods (needs emptying).
• Grain residues left on rail siding
• Machinery, equipment and tools scattered around storage
• General rubbish left around storage
• Rubbish bins full and need to be emptied

Hygiene Standards Internal Vertical and Horizontal
GOOD
• Free of grain and dust residues in tunnels, boots, hopper, towers, catwalks etc
• Grain handling tools storages as per 5S
• No general rubbish
• Free of rodent and bird carcasses, feathers and droppings less than 1 week old
• The standard required for residual treatment
FAIR
• Attempt made to clean grain residues and spills
• Free of neglected accumulation of grain and dust ie piles of grain growing in boots
• Spill or heavy build-ups cleaned on a two-weekly basis

POOR
• No attempt made to clean grain residues and spills
• Heavy grain and dust residues in tunnels, boots, hopper, towers, catwalks etc
• General rubbish left in storage
• Grain handling tools left in poor condition
• Hygiene neglected during and after grain handling activity, a standard that is not to be tolerated.
